Some simple tips for Small Indexers "How to be more profitable"

My colleagues also asked me to add some info about safety. It’s not about profitability directly, but I agree that it’s really important. So, a little bit more about it.

  1. Check your POI (via Poifer: POIFIER - user-friendly tool for verification of indexing data consistency or POI checker: GitHub - p2p-org/graphprotocol-poi-checker: Python script to check POI across multi indexers for defined subgraph). It’s really important because it will show you that the data Indexed by you is consistent with the network. And you don’t have this kind of problem with your Ethereum node. It will also provide you more confidence that you will not be slashed if you worked an honest way.
  2. As an opposite of #5 from “Indexing reward tips”. As I said before it’s quite risky to do like this but what I didn’t say is “how to do it the right way”. A more logical and safe way is off-chain sync potentially interesting subgraphs and only after they will be fully synced → allocate to them. It will protect you from all factors that I listed above in #5.
  3. I also mentioned that you need to calculate everything in #4. But I need to add, that in most cases, for small indexers, it doesn’t make sense to reallocate too often. Because it will be too expensive for you. In most cases, even if some Indexers jump in, the proportion will go down to the average, not lower. So it could be more profitable for you just to stay there till the 26-28 epoch and then jumping to something more profitable (diamonds again :wink: ).
4 Likes